What Are Surety Contract Bonds?



Surety Contract bonds are a sort of financial assurance that gives assurance to job owners that specialists will accomplish their contractual responsibilities. These bonds serve as a form of security for the job proprietor by making sure that the professional will finish the project as set, or compensate for any monetary loss sustained.

When a contractor obtains a surety bond, they're essentially becoming part of a legitimately binding arrangement with a guaranty company. This agreement specifies that the professional will certainly satisfy their commitments and meet all contractual needs. If the professional stops working to do so, the guaranty company will action in and offer the required funds to finish the task or compensate the project owner for any damages.

This way, Surety Contract bonds supply peace of mind to job proprietors and alleviate the threats connected with hiring contractors.

Understanding the Duty of Guaranty Bonding Firms



Currently allow's discover the essential function that surety bonding business play in the world of Surety Contract bonds.

Guaranty bonding business function as a third party that assures the Performance and gratification of legal commitments. They provide a financial guarantee to the obligee, usually the project owner, that the principal, generally the professional, will certainly complete the job according to the terms of the Contract.

On the occasion that the principal falls short to meet their obligations, the surety bonding company steps in to make sure that the task is completed or that the obligee is made up for any monetary losses.
